Output 86e2fde2b22a2d68520415ee39fe8bf8d63d7c27a74c132f1204c1845dd847bb:2

value
1362531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 115fa5a3e1585c946129a8c381573861a8530f9a OP_EQUAL
address
33GszUdPcEDg8zHFB4xAn6RHQqaKcT4LF4
transaction
86e2fde2b22a2d68520415ee39fe8bf8d63d7c27a74c132f1204c1845dd847bb
spent
true